The History of Met Breuer Nyc
The Met Breuer Nyc opened its doors in March 2016, marking a significant expansion of the Metropolitan Museum of Art's reach into modern and contemporary art. The building itself is a work of art, with its distinctive geometric shapes and raw concrete surfaces. The decision to house modern and contemporary art in this space was strategic, as it allowed the Met to showcase a broader range of artistic expressions and periods.
The building's history is as rich as its architecture. Originally constructed in 1966, it was designed by Marcel Breuer, a Hungarian-born architect known for his contributions to the Brutalist movement. The building's design reflects Breuer's signature style, characterized by its use of raw materials and bold geometric forms. The Met Breuer Nyc has since become a symbol of modern architecture in New York City, attracting visitors from around the world.
